OLD-FASHIONED RICE PUDDING I



Old-Fashioned Rice Pudding I image

This pudding turns out in a lovely custard texture. A great balm for those seeking a return to some of the old-fashioned foods of their youth! We like it best because it is oven-baked and not made on the stove top.

Provided by Juanita

Categories     Desserts     Custards and Pudding Recipes     Rice Pudding Recipes

Time 2h45m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 eggs, beaten
4 cups milk
½ cup white sugar
½ cup uncooked white rice
1 tablespoon butter
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
½ cup raisins
⅛ teaspoon ground nutmeg

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C). Grease a 2 quart baking dish.
  • Beat together the eggs and milk. Stir in white sugar, uncooked rice, butter, vanilla extract, raisins, and nutmeg. Pour into prepared pan.
  • Bake for 2 to 2 1/2 hours in the preheated oven. Stir frequently during the first hour.

GRANDMA'S RICE PUDDING



Grandma's Rice Pudding image

My sisters and I always loved the recipe for rice pudding our grandma made. After she passed away, I took it upon myself to try and find the secret to her rice pudding. It took quite a bit of experimentation, but I finally got it right! And I'm glad to share this easy recipe here. -Margaret DeChant, Newberry, Michigan

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 55m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 7

1-1/2 cups cooked rice
1/4 cup raisins
2 large eggs
1-1/2 cups whole milk
1/2 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
Additional milk, optional

Steps:

  • Place rice and raisins in a greased 1-qt. casserole. In a small bowl, whisk the eggs, milk, sugar and nutmeg; pour over rice. , Bake, uncovered, at 375° for 45-50 minutes or until a knife in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ool. Pour milk over each serving if desired. Refrigerate leftovers.

OLD-FASHIONED RICE PUDDING



Old-Fashioned Rice Pudding image

This comforting dessert is a wonderful way to end any meal. As a girl, I always waited eagerly for the first heavenly bite. Today, my husband likes to top his with a scoop of ice cream. -Sandra Melnychenko, Grandview, Manitoba

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 1h10m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 7

3-1/2 cups 2% milk
1/2 cup uncooked long grain rice
1/3 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up raisins
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Ground cinnamon, optional

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325°. Place first four ingredients in a large saucepan; bring to a boil over medium heat, stirring constantly. Transfer to a greased 1-1/2-qt. baking dish. , Bake, covered, 45 minutes, stirring every 15 minutes. Stir in raisins and vanilla; bake, covered, until rice is tender, about 15 minutes. If desired, sprinkle with cinnamon. Serve warm or refrigerate and serve cold.

CHEF JOHN'S CLASSIC RICE PUDDING



Chef John's Classic Rice Pudding image

For whatever reason, rice pudding is usually not near the top when people list their favorite desserts, but despite that, it's a proven crowd-pleaser, and quite easy to make, especially using this simplified, one-pot method.

Provided by Chef John

Categories     Desserts     Fruit Dessert Recipes     Cherry Dessert Recipes

Time 3h35m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

½ cup uncooked long-grain white rice
¼ teaspoon kosher salt
1 cup water
¼ cup white sugar
1 ⅓ cups milk
½ teaspoon vanilla extract
⅛ te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 large egg yolk
1 tablespoon cold butter
2 tablespoons dried cherries, chopped

Steps:

  • Place rice, salt, and water into a saucepan.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Reduce heat to low, cover, and cook until tender, about 20 minutes. Remove from heat; sprinkle with sugar and pour in milk. Stir with a whisk until until the thin layer of cooked-on starch at the bottom of the pan is cleared and incorporated into the mixture, 2 or 3 minutes.
  • Place pan over medium heat, stirring frequently, until it reaches your desired of level of doneness and creaminess, 8 to 10 minutes. The longer it cooks, the thicker and stickier it will be. Remove from heat. Add vanilla and cinnamon. Very quickly whisk in the egg yolk (to prevent it from cooking). Whisk for about 1 more minute. Add butter and dried cherries; stir thoroughly.
  • Transfer warm pudding to serving dishes. Cool to room temperature. Cover and refrigerate until thoroughly chilled, 3 to 4 hours.

CLASSIC RICE PUDDING



Classic rice pudding image

Have this creamy rice pudding cooking in the oven while you make dinner and round off your meal with a comforting pud. Serve with jam for a feel-good treat

Provided by Esther Clark

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h35m

Number Of Ingredients 8

butter, for the dish
130g pudding rice
70g caster sugar
2 tsp vanilla bean paste or 1 vanilla pod, split and seeds scraped out
800ml whole milk
170ml double cream
grating of nutmeg
fruit jam of your choice, to serve (strawberry or apricot work well)

Steps:

  • Heat the oven to 160C/140C fan/gas 3 and butter a 1.5-litre baking dish. Put the pudding rice, sugar, vanilla, milk and cream in a bowl and stir to combine. Pour the mixture into the prepared dish and grate over a generous layer of nutmeg. Bake for 1 hr 30 mins until a brown skin has formed on top and the rice is cooked and tender.
  • Leave to cool slightly, then scoop the warm pudding into bowls and serve with a dollop of jam on top.

INSTANT POT® OLD-FASHIONED RICE PUDDING



Instant Pot® Old-Fashioned Rice Pudding image

This recipe merges old-fashioned taste with modern technology! Rib sticking, good ol' fashioned rice pudding ready in a fraction of the normal time using an Instant Pot®!

Provided by Netsirk

Categories     Desserts     Custards and Pudding Recipes     Rice Pudding Recipes

Time 50m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 7

3 ⅓ cups whole milk
½ cup white sugar
½ cup long-grain white rice
2 large eggs
¼ cup raisins
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
½ teaspoon ground cinnamon

Steps:

  • Turn on a multi-functional pressure cooker (such as Instant Pot®) and select Saute function. Stir in milk and sugar. Warm the mixture, stirring continuously, until sugar dissolves, 3 to 4 minutes. Turn Instant Pot® off. Add rice. Close and lock the lid.
  • Select high pressure according to manufacturer's instructions; set timer for 15 minutes. Allow 10 to 15 minutes for pressure to build.
  • Release pressure using the natural-release method according to manufacturer's instructions, at least 10 minutes.
  • Beat eggs in a bowl. Remove lid of the Instant Pot®. Scoop 1 cup of pudding mixture out of the pot; add to the beaten eggs and whisk until completely blended. Pour back into the Instant Pot® and add raisins, vanilla extract, and cinnamon.
  • Select Saute function. Cook until mixture thickens, about 3 minutes. Serve warm or chilled.

OLD-FASHIONED RICE PUDDING II



Old-Fashioned Rice Pudding II image

This is a simple, plain rice pudding that will remind you of your grandmothers'! It's white rice baked with sugar, scalded milk and butter.

Provided by Kim

Categories     Desserts     Custards and Pudding Recipes     Rice Pudding Recipes

Time 1h35m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 5

⅓ cup uncooked white rice, not rinsed
¼ teaspoon salt
¼ cup white sugar
1 quart milk, scalded
2 teaspoons butter

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C).
  • In a 1 quart baking dish combine rice, salt and sugar. Stir in scalded milk and dot with butter.
  • Bake in preheated oven for 1 1/2 hours, or until rice is very tender and milk is thick and creamy. Stir gently with a fork every 15 minutes during the first hour.

OLD FASHIONED CREAMY RICE PUDDING



Old Fashioned Creamy Rice Pudding image

Cooked rice is combined with milk, sugar, and an egg and flavored with butter and vanilla in this quick stovetop rice pudding.

Provided by Jennifer Korpak Bechtel

Categories     Desserts     Custards and Pudding Recipes     Rice Pudding Recipes

Time 30m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 ½ cups cooked rice
2 cups milk, divided
¼ teaspoon salt
⅔ cup golden raisins
1 egg, beaten
⅓ cup white sugar
1 tablespoon butter
½ te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Combine cooked rice, 1 1/2 cups milk, and salt in a saucepan over medium heat; cook and stir until thick and creamy, 15 to 20 minutes. Stir remaining 1/2 cup milk, golden raisins, beaten egg, and white sugar into the rice mixture; stirring continually. Continue cooking until egg is set, 2 to 3 minutes. Remove saucepan from heat; stir butter and vanilla extract into the pudding.
